Marathon GSAR (Government Search & Rescue) Diver's Automatic

The Marathon GSAR (Government Search & Rescue) Diver's Automatic is widely praised for its legibility, comfort, and exceptional tritium illumination, with reviewers highlighting its utilitarian, military-equipment feel and a 41mm case size considered ideal. Owners appreciate its grippy bezel and the 300 meters of water resistance provided by the screw-down crown, deeming it a solid value for a Swiss-made tool watch. Some owners report quality control issues, with one user needing to warranty two watches, and another notes the GSAR wears taller than other models, leading to occasional bumping. The reliable ETA 2824-A2 movement is a consistent feature.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Marathon GSAR (Government Search & Rescue) Diver's Automatic highly for its bright tritium lume and robust, no-nonsense tool watch design.

Seiko Presage Sharp Edged Series

The Seiko Presage Sharp Edged Series is widely lauded for its sharp, angular case design and the intricate finishing of its dials, often featuring traditional Japanese motifs like the Asanoha pattern. Owners and reviewers consistently highlight the beautiful interplay of polished and hairline finishes on the case and bracelet, the use of sapphire crystals, and a robust 100m water resistance. The collection is powered by reliable in-house automatic movements, with many models featuring the 6R35 movement offering a 70-hour power reserve. Some specific models are noted for their refined finishing and updated case facets, while the 24-hour sub-dial on certain variants is considered a niche complication.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Seiko Presage Sharp Edged Series highly for its striking design and quality finishing at its price point.
